"birchy" meaning in English

See birchy in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Adjective

IPA: /ˈbɜːtʃi/ [Received-Pronunciation] Forms: more birchy [comparative], most birchy [superlative]
Rhymes: -ɜː(ɹ)tʃi Etymology: From birch + -y. Etymology templates: {{suffix|en|birch|y}} birch + -y Head templates: {{en-adj}} birchy (comparative more birchy, superlative most birchy)
  1. Resembling or characteristic of birch.
